NUJ Press Week: Inter-Chapel Scrabble Competition Holds Tomorrow
Seventeen contestants from 11 Chapels of the Nigeria Union of Journalists (NUJ) have been registered to participate in a scrabble competition, as part of the activities marking the 2023 Kwara NUJ Press Week.
According to the Secretary of the Committee, AbdulRosheed Okiki, nine male and eight players were registered by 11 of the 12 Chapels affiliated to the NUJ to participate in the competition which has been scheduled to come up on Wednesday December 20th, 2023, at the NUJ Press Centre, Offa Road, GRA, Ilorin.
The male contestants are Yinka Alabere (State Information), Ibrahim Soliu (Radio Kwara), Sodiq Adebara (Harmony FM), Bukola Sanni (NOA), Yinka Owolewa (Correspondents'), Dauda Lateef (Federal Information), Adebowale Adeniyi Kwara TV), Bunmi Obafemi (Unilorin FM), Dare Akogun (Sobi FM) and Ahmed Ajiboye (The Herald Newspaper).
Taiwo Okanlawon of the State Information Chapel tops the list of the eight female contestants, who include Hauwa Alimi (Radio Kwara), Raliat Ibrahim (NTA, Ilorin), Opeyemi Olaseni (Harmony FM), Bukola Jimoh (Federal Information), Fatima Rasheed (Kwara TV), and Janet Bogunjoko (The Herald Newspaper).
The competition, being sponsored by Pat Technologies Limited, and tagged 'Kwara NUJ/Plat Technologies Limited Inter-Chapel Scrabble Tournament will begin from 12.00noon, and end by 5.00pm, tomorrow.
The Press Week will commence same day with Medical check-up for members, by 9.00am, at the Press Centre, and will be followed with the scrabble competition.
The grand finale of the Press Week will come up on Thursday, December 21, 2023, at the same venue, NUJ Press Centre, by 4pm.
The competition will be supervised by the Kwara State Scrabble Association.
